Which best describes why truth describes her personal experiences in "ain't i a woman?"

Respuesta :

chuyjesc
chuyjesc chuyjesc
  • 18-10-2019

Answer:

To provide credible proof that women are not protected from hardship

Explanation:

Truth describes her experiences when see performes manual labor and when she is suffering other hardships in order to express that women are not only exposed to these hardships, but they are truly capable of taking them on with just as much, or even more, strength as a man.
